About Master in Advanced Practice

Tuition fees are 15,151 USD per year.

The Master in Advanced Practice at Anglia Ruskin University is for healthcare professionals. This 5-year master's degree helps students enhance their clinical autonomy and expertise in medicine.

The curriculum covers clinical practice, education, research, and leadership. Students learn through collaborative study and share insights with peers, gaining a deeper understanding of healthcare policies and practices.

Graduates can pursue roles like Clinical Nurse Specialist, Advanced Practice Registered Nurse, or Healthcare Manager in clinical settings, primary or secondary care, and further their academic pursuits, such as PhD programs.

About Anglia Ruskin University

Anglia Ruskin University, located in Cambridge, United Kingdom, is a modern university that stands out for its inclusive atmosphere and strong regional presence. You'll find advantages in its award-winning student support services, focus on employability, and dedicated International Office. With a rich history dating back to 1858, ARU has evolved into a leading institution that offers a unique experience for international students.

Specifically, ARU focuses on fields like arts, humanities, business, law, health, medicine, and science. The university is home to 297 programs, including those offered by the renowned Cambridge School of Art and the first School of Medicine in Essex. Research areas like the Global Sustainability Institute and the Vision and Eye Research Institute drive innovation in health, technology, and social sciences, providing you with opportunities to engage in cutting-edge research.
